1. Discover the Latest Trends: How Employer Branding Software Enhances Retention Rates
In the competitive landscape of talent acquisition, employer branding software has emerged as a game-changer in enhancing retention rates. Companies leveraging these innovative tools witness a remarkable difference: a study from LinkedIn revealed that organizations with strong employer branding can experience a 50% reduction in turnover rates . By harnessing features that allow for tailored employee engagement strategies and real-time sentiment analysis, businesses can craft a workplace narrative that resonates deeply with their workforce. For instance, glowing employee testimonials and interactive career pages not only attract talent but also create a sense of belonging and commitment, vital for retention.
Furthermore, the integration of data analytics within employer branding software unveils powerful insights about employee preferences and engagement levels. Research from Gallup indicates that engaged employees are 87% less likely to leave their company . Companies using employer branding tools can monitor engagement metrics and adapt their strategies based on real-time feedback. This continuous loop of adaptation and communication fosters a culture of trust and loyalty that keeps employees invested in their organizations. By staying ahead of these trends and making data-driven decisions, businesses not only improve their retention rates but also cultivate an invigorated workplace culture that thrives on innovation and mutual growth.
2. Data-Driven Insights: Leveraging Statistics to Measure Employee Retention Success
Data-driven insights play a pivotal role in evaluating the effectiveness of employer branding software in enhancing employee retention rates. By leveraging statistics such as turnover rates, employee satisfaction scores, and engagement metrics, organizations can identify key factors that contribute to retention success. For instance, a study by Gallup found that companies with high employee engagement levels experience 25% less turnover . Implementing features like predictive analytics in employer branding software enables organizations to analyze historical data and forecast retention trends, thus allowing HR professionals to take proactive measures. Using employee surveys to gather real-time insights can inform strategies that align with workforce needs, demonstrating a clear correlation between a robust employer brand and retention metrics.
Furthermore, organizations can adopt best practices informed by statistical insights to create more appealing workplace environments. For instance, according to a Deloitte report, companies that prioritize employee well-being report up to a 25% increase in performance and are significantly more likely to retain employees . Features in employer branding software that facilitate the personalization of employee experiences—like tailored onboarding processes, recognition programs, and continuous feedback mechanisms—can respond more effectively to the needs of their workforce. Analogous to a well-cared-for garden that flourishes with the right nutrients, employees are more likely to thrive in an environment that nurtures their professional growth and satisfaction, resulting in improved retention metrics.
3. Top Employer Branding Tools: A Comparative Analysis for Improved Retention
In the dynamic world of employer branding, organizations are increasingly turning to sophisticated software tools to enhance their appeal and retain top talent. A recent study by LinkedIn revealed that companies with strong employer branding can attract 50% more qualified applicants and reduce turnover rates by up to 28% . Tools like Glassdoor and Indeed's Employer Insights allow businesses to gather real-time feedback from employees, giving them a precise understanding of their workforce's sentiment. Companies using these platforms experience a marked reduction in hiring time and an increase in employee engagement, with data showing engaged employees are 87% less likely to leave their organization .
Another cornerstone of effective employer branding tools is the integration of artificial intelligence to personalize the employee experience. According to a report by Forrester, organizations leveraging AI-driven insights for talent management witness a 10% lift in employee retention rates . Tools like Workday and BambooHR utilize predictive analytics to identify at-risk employees and recommend targeted retention strategies, ensuring that not only is recruitment streamlined, but that the existing workforce feels valued and engaged. By harnessing the power of data and feedback, businesses not only reduce turnover but cultivate a loyal, enthusiastic workforce that propels organizational success.
4. Real-World Success Stories: How Leading Companies Boost Retention Through Branding
Leading companies have successfully leveraged innovative employer branding software to enhance employee retention rates. For instance, Adobe implemented a robust employee experience platform that emphasizes personal development, flexibility, and recognition. By utilizing features such as continuous feedback loops and internal mobility options, Adobe reported a retention rate of 91% among employees. This aligns with studies showing that organizations with strong employer branding see a 50% reduction in employee turnover . Similarly, IBM's use of advanced analytics in their employer branding strategy helps tailor job offers to align with individual employee aspirations, fostering a sense of belonging and increasing overall job satisfaction.
Another noteworthy example is Salesforce, which focuses on its inclusive culture and strong values to attract and retain talent. With a clear messaging strategy that highlights diversity and employee support programs, Salesforce enjoys a turnover rate of only 8% compared to the industry average of 13.2% . Companies can adopt similar practices by investing in employer branding software that features employee storytelling and personalization tools, ensuring that their brand resonates with current and prospective employees. As research indicates, organizations that effectively communicate their values through branding achieve not only higher retention rates but also enhanced engagement, leading to improved overall performance .
5. Predictive Analytics: Using Data to Anticipate Employee Turnover and Retain Talent
Employers today face a daunting challenge: employee turnover. With statistics showing that nearly 60% of employees are considering leaving their current jobs based on a survey by LinkedIn , the need for predictive analytics in employer branding software has never been more critical. By leveraging advanced data analytics, organizations can identify key factors contributing to turnover and proactively address them. For instance, predictive models can assess employee engagement scores alongside exit interview data to unveil underlying patterns and pinpoint at-risk employees. A study by the Predictive Analytics Institute revealed that organizations utilizing predictive analytics to anticipate turnover experienced a 15% reduction in attrition rates, emphasizing the importance of data-driven strategies in retaining talent.
Moreover, integrating insights from predictive analytics not only aids in retention but also fosters a culture of engagement and satisfaction. A Gallup report highlighted that companies with high employee engagement show a 21% increase in profitability . Using these insights, innovative employer branding software can help tailor personalized employee experiences, from targeted development opportunities to improving workplace culture. For example, if data reveals that a significant number of high-performing employees leave due to lack of advancement opportunities, organizations can implement mentorship programs or offer tailored career paths. This proactive approach not only mitigates turnover but also transforms the employer brand into one that fosters long-lasting talent relationships.
6. Crafting Compelling Narratives: The Role of Storytelling in Employer Branding
Crafting compelling narratives is essential in employer branding, as storytelling humanizes the brand and fosters emotional connections with potential employees. For instance, the use of employee testimonials in recruitment marketing can enhance authenticity; a study by the Talent Board found that candidates who read positive employee stories are 50% more likely to apply for roles. Companies like Salesforce leverage storytelling effectively through engaging video narratives that highlight employee experiences and organizational culture, making the workplace not just a job, but a community. Incorporating powerful narratives in employer branding software can not only attract top talent but also reinforce existing employees' connection to the brand, significantly boosting retention rates. To exemplify, a compelling narrative can be as influential as a well-crafted marketing campaign, reinforcing that every employee's journey within the company is a story worth telling.
Furthermore, effective storytelling in employer branding can also serve as a powerful tool for employee engagement. For instance, JetBlue features employees' personal stories in its recruitment efforts, not only showcasing the company culture but also establishing a relatable human element that prospective employees resonate with. This approach can lead to a 30% increase in employee engagement, as highlighted in research by Gallup, which found that engaged employees are 87% less likely to leave their organizations. By integrating storytelling elements into employer branding software, organizations can create a more immersive experience, promoting a sense of belonging and loyalty among employees. The key is to ensure authenticity in storytelling; it should reflect the true culture and values of the organization, as noted in studies showing that 70% of job seekers prioritize company culture when evaluating potential jobs.
